I have recently update my Final Cut Pro X to Final Cut Pro X 10.1. I downloaded the update from the app store. Now every time I open Final Cut it crashes almost instantly. What can I do?- I really need help!
It sounds as though you have a corrupt project - or possibly a file within an event that is causing the application to crash.
Quit FCP X, then move your projects and events (if you have any) to new folders so that FCP X doesn't find them, then relaunch the application. If it launches OK, there's a very good chance one of your projects or events is causing the problem.
Quit the app again, then move one event or project at a time back to the original folder and launch FCP X again - keep going until you find the cause.

I recently upgraded to snow leopard and now every time i open iCal i get multiple events to update in iCal. Except I don't know where these are coming from or why. I've check iCal preferences and Help - can't find a way to stop this from happening automatically. Any Clues? Also, some of the events are already on my calendar and have been for quite some time.
Greetings,
What do you mean by "events to update"? Do you mean invites to new events or changes to existing invites?
Troubleshooting:
1. Your profile indicates you are running 10.6.7, 10.6.8 is the current version Apple > Software update.
2. First make an iCal backup: Click on each calendar on the left hand side of iCal 1 at a time highlighting it's name and then going to File Export > Export and saving the resulting calendar file to a logical location for safekeeping.
3. Remove the following to the trash and restart your computer:
Home > Library > Caches > com.apple.ical
Home > Library > Calendars > Calendar Cache, Cache, Cache 1, 2, 3, etc. (Do not remove Sync Cache or Theme Cache if present)
Home > Library > Preferences > com.apple.ical (There may be more than one of these. Remove them all.)
---NOTE: Removing these files may remove any shared (CalDAV) calendars you may have access to. You will have to re-add those calendars to iCal > Preferences > Accounts.
3. Launch iCal and test.

I'm not able to download free apps from App Store. Every time I try a message encounters me showing some billing information. That doesn't make any sense as I just need to download free app. What should I do? Please guide me someone.
If you only want the free apps, take a look here:
http://support.apple.com/kb/HT2534
Read the steps carefully as the order in which you follow them is critical. Note that you can do this only when creating a new Apple ID. You cannot use an existing ID.
You will of course not be able to get anything other than the free apps without entering in some sort of payment method (credit card, prepaid iTunes card, gift certificate, etc.)
